ZIP Code 05492: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 05492?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 05492 is $242,900, higher than 60%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 05492?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 05492 is $4,114, an effective rate of 2%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 05492 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 05492 cost about 3.58× the median household income, higher than 67%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the average rent in ZIP Code 05492?
- The median gross rent in ZIP Code 05492 is $1,110 a month, higher than 67%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 05492?
- ZIP Code 05492 averages 41.6°F year-round, summer highs near 73.8°F, winter lows around 8.4°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 139.3 inches of snow a year.
- Is ZIP Code 05492 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 05492's FEMA National Risk Index score is 24.5 (lower than 88% of U.S. ZIP codes).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is hurricane.
